FanDuel CEO Amy Howe Out After Five Years Leading Sportsbook
Amy Howe has been ousted as CEO of FanDuel after five years at the company. Christian Genetski, FanDuel's president, is set to assume the leadership role. The change comes as Flutter, FanDuel's parent company, faces investor pressure, with its shares declining amid broader concerns in the gaming sector. Flutter recently adjusted its 2026 guidance, citing softer Q4 performance and increased investment needs in platforms like FanDuel Predicts. Howe, who was noted as one of the few female leaders in the industry, previously focused on responsible gaming initiatives.
